  4. The tetratronic rippler is, hands down, the best cyberdeck in the game right now. Ultimate cheesehacks like suicide, and cyberpsychosis cost a lot of ram, and are on a 120 sec cooldown. Having them upload to two targets instead of one, with a 45% reduction in cooldown is way overpowered. Basically, as soon as a fight starts, breach protocol (with the perk that automatically uploads the first daemon on the list), then force two enemies to instantly suicide, then cyberpsycho two others, take cover, and short circuit/synapse burnout whatever is left.
